Finding Wildlife in the 3rd Largest Metropolitan area in North America might be hard to imagine, however all the photos and Videos were taken within 75 km of the CN Tower. Mostly in the west end where I live. PLease enjoy this collection from the Spring of 2024 and get outside and Explore, you never know what you will find!
